Abstract

Abstract The purpose of this research activity was to create a model for empowering MSMEs in wetland areas after the flood disaster. The model that would be produced in this study was expected to be able to contribute in increasing the resilience of SMEs after the disaster in the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ency. The specific objectives of this study were a) Identifying the characteristics of MSME empowerment in the post-flood wetland area in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ency, b) Analyzing the pattern of MSME empowerment in the post-flood wetland area in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ency, c) Developing a MSME empowerment model in post-flood wetland area in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ency. The research used a quantitative method with a survey approach to MSMEs affected by the flood disaster in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ency using research instruments and supported by in-depth interviews to map the problems and policies that would be taken in empowering MSMEs affected by the disaster. Furthermore, a literature study was used to synchronize field conditions with all local government programs and related stakeholders to be assembled into a model for empowering MSMEs in post-disaster wetland areas in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ency. The data collection used field research and library research. The AHP method used Rapfish Software to formulate a structured decision model formulation with AHP modeling to set priorities for empowering MSMEs in post-flood disaster wetland areas in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ency. The results of research data analysis using Expert Choice 11 from expert respondents (Local Governments, MSMEs, Universities, and Companies), obtained the results of the criteria for marketing facilities (20%) and priorities/alternatives for MSME business resilience (38%) as strategies in empowerment program and increase the resilience of MSMEs post-flood disaster in wetland areas in Hulu Sungai Tengah Regency. Abstract

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the Business Model Canvas on Business Performance at Lampit MSMEs in Hulu Sungai Utara Regency. The purpose of this research activity is to test and evaluate the Business Model Canvas on Business Performance and evaluate the Business Model Canvas on Lampit MSMEs in the Wetland Area of ​​Hulu Sungai Utara Regency. The model produced in this study is expected to be able to contribute to improving Lampit MSMEs in Hulu Sungai Utara Regency. The methods used are quantitative and qualitative. Quantitative research aims to test to determine the value of independent variables, either one or more variables (independent) without making comparisons, or connecting with other variables. While Qualitative aims to describe/construct in-depth interviews with research subjects so that they can provide a clear picture of the Business Model Canvas analysis in improving business performance at Lampit MSMEs in Hulu Sungai Utara Regency. The results of data processing using the Partial Least Square analysis model using the SmartPLS computer program, obtained the results that the Business Model Canvas (Customer Segment, Customer Relationship, Customer Channel, Revenue Structure, Value Proposition, Key Activities, Key Resources, Cost Structure, and Key Partners) has an effect on the business performance of Lampit MSMEs, while the results using SWOT analysis show that Lampit MSMEs have indirectly implemented the Business Model Canvas concept in carrying out their business and the application of the Business Model Canvas to Lampit MSME Products can help Lampit MSMEs survive and develop Keywords: Business Model Canvas, Business Performance, SWOT

Abstract

ABSTRACT : This study aims to conduct a Du Pont System analysis (ROI, NPM and TATO) in measuring the financial performance of telecommunications companies listed on the Indonesia stock exchange for the 2015-2019 period. The research approach uses quantitative, with the type of research the comparative-associative. Samples were taken of all components in the form of company data, namely telecommunications company financial data that measures the value of NPM (Net Profit Margin), TATO (Total Assets Turnover) and ROI (Return On Investment) 2015-2019, census sampling technique / total sampling. Data collection used secondary data with documentation study, while data analysis used descriptive statistical analysis and two way ANOVA. The results prove that H1 is rejected, meaning that there is no difference in the financial performance of telecommunications companies 2015-2019 based on financial ratio grouping, with a sig. 0.86. H2 is accepted, meaning that there is a difference in the financial performance of telecommunications companies for 2015-2019 based on grouping of business entities (companies), with a sig. 0.45. And H3 is accepted, meaning that there is a du pont system interaction with telecommunications companies in the financial performance of telecommunications companies 2015-2019, with a sig value of 0.021.
